Output 70d0d8b5e0ae704f6ca4ec36813c18226ee1e2626fdb5efd53221230352e50fb:1

value
1480001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5bc341c1fb6d7cb7d038826b37ce9d4acee8678 OP_EQUAL
address
3Ndk85tZaqmmUE8oHUdQL4rfUn7hVQsfF2
transaction
70d0d8b5e0ae704f6ca4ec36813c18226ee1e2626fdb5efd53221230352e50fb
confirmations
347442
spent
true